Program Description

Legal Administrative Assistants prepare and process a variety of legal documents, including complaints, motions, summonses and subpoenas. In addition, their duties include composing and processing letters and other correspondence, calendaring, greeting clients, filing and bookkeeping.

Employment Trends

According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, employment opportunities will be plentiful for well qualified and experienced legal administrative assistants. Several hundred thousand positions are generated each year as experienced legal administrative assistants are promoted to paralegal positions, with additional education, or leave the labor force. The trend for legal administrative assistants to be given more responsibilities will also increase the demand. Legal administrative assistants can be useful to law firms, corporate legal departments, and government agencies.
